Efficient Use of Space

When designing your restaurant layout, it's essential to make the most efficient use of the available space. The goal is to maximize seating capacity while still allowing enough room for guests to move around comfortably. One way to achieve this is by carefully planning the arrangement of tables and chairs. Consider using a mix of different table sizes to accommodate various group sizes, from couples to larger parties. Additionally, think about the flow of traffic in the dining area and ensure that there are clear pathways for staff and customers to navigate the space without feeling crowded.

Another aspect to consider when designing your restaurant layout for maximum seating efficiency is the use of multi-functional furniture. For example, opt for booths with built-in storage underneath or tables that can be easily rearranged to accommodate different party sizes. By choosing versatile furniture pieces, you can make the most of your space and increase your seating capacity without compromising comfort for your guests.

Comfortable Seating Arrangements

In addition to maximizing seating capacity, it's crucial to prioritize comfort when designing your restaurant layout. Uncomfortable seating arrangements can quickly turn customers off and discourage them from returning. Invest in high-quality chairs and booths that provide adequate support and cushioning for guests to sit comfortably for an extended period. Consider the height and depth of the seats to ensure that diners of all ages and sizes can relax and enjoy their meal without feeling cramped or awkward.

Furthermore, pay attention to the spacing between tables to allow for privacy and a sense of personal space for each group of diners. Avoid cramming tables too closely together, as this can make guests feel claustrophobic and disrupt their dining experience. Instead, aim for a balance between maximizing seating capacity and maintaining a comfortable distance between tables to promote a relaxed and enjoyable atmosphere.
